首页 > 数据库 >在 SQL Server 中应该选择 MONEY 还是 DECIMAL(x,y) 数据类型?

在 SQL Server 中应该选择 MONEY 还是 DECIMAL(x,y) 数据类型?

时间:2023-03-03 11:44:37浏览次数:51  
标签:money MONEY DECIMAL 数据类型 Server SQL decimal

money我很好奇数据类型和类似的东西之间是否存在真正的区别decimal(19,4)(我相信这是金钱在内部使用的东西)。

我知道这money是特定于 SQL Server 的。我想知道是否有令人信服的理由选择其中一个;大多数 SQL Server 示例(例如 AdventureWorks 数据库)使用moneyand 不decimal用于诸如价格信息之类的事情。

我应该继续使用 money 数据类型,还是改用 decimal 有好处吗?金钱意味着输入的字符更少,但这不是一个正当理由 :)



解答

http://www.stackoverflow.ink/posts/zai-sql-server-zhong-ying-gai-xuan-ze-money-huan-shi-decimal-x-y-shu-ju-lei-xing/

标签:money,MONEY,DECIMAL,数据类型,Server,SQL,decimal
From: https://www.cnblogs.com/silva/p/17175024.html

相关文章

  • 数据类型扩展
    进制以及转换二进制0b开头八进制0开头十六进制0x开头转换:0x106=6乘以16的0次方+0乘以16的一次方+1乘以16的二次方=浮点数拓展float具有有限离散舍入......
  • 数据类型
    数据类型语言类型强类型语言:要求变量使用符合严格的规则,所有变量必须先定义后才能使用弱类型语言:不需要定义就可以使用,比如JavaScript里面的类型定义数据类型基本数......
  • 实验1 C语言开发环境使用和数据类型、运算符、表达式
     1.实验1task1_1 1//打印一个字符小人2#include<stdio.h>3intmain()4{5printf("o\n");6printf("<H>\n");7printf("II\n");......
  • chapter 2 变量和简单数据类型
    Chapter2变量和简单数据类型本章主要讲述:在Python程序中使用的各种数据;如何将数据存储到变量中;如何在程序中使用这些数据。2.1运行hello_world.py时发生的情况。代码如......
  • 【编程基础之Python】7、Python基本数据类型
    (【编程基础之Python】7、Python基本数据类型)Python基本数据类型Python是一种动态类型语言,它支持多种基本数据类型和复合数据类型,让开发人员能够更加方便地处理不同类型......
  • kotlin基本数据类型
    通过idea创建kotlin项目:创建kotlin文件packagecom.czhappy.chapter01varaBoolean:Boolean=truevaranInt:Int=9varanotherInt:Int=0xFFvarmaxInt:Int=Int.MAX......
  • mysql5.7之JSON数据类型
    1、json对象1.1、方法使用对象操作的方法进行查询:字段->'$.json属性'使用函数进行查询:json_extract(字段,'$.json属性')获取JSON数组/对象长度:JSON_LENGTH()1.2、......
  • 数据类型转换关系
    //数据类型的扩展位(bit):是计算机内部数据储存的最小单位,11001100是一个八位二进制数。字节(byte):是计算机中数据处理的基本单位,习惯上用大写B来表示,1B(byte,字节)=8bit......
  • C++--抽象数据类型
              ......
  • 改Pandas中列的数据类型的几种方法
    改Pandas中列的数据类型的几种方法pandas中常见的数据类型pandaspythontypenummpytypeusageobjectstrstring_,unicode_Textint64intint_,int8,int1......